Market segmentation




The whole market  market segmentation  reduce homogeneity  heterogeneity

Market reaction measurement – Customer segmentation
Segmentation: identification of customer groups that respond differently from other groups to
competitive offers. A segmentation strategy couples the identified segments with a (specific)
program to deliver an offering to those segments.
Customer segmentation: marketers cannot satisfy everyone in a market  start by dividing the
markets into segments. Identify and profile distinct groups of buyers who might prefer or require
varying products.

Dilemma  the most important
segmentations are the most difficult to
measure and target.




Benefits segmentation:
- Assess customer preferences/benefits and additionally also other (easy to observe)
variables such as age, sex, etc.
- Define clusters of customers based on preferences/benefits (e.g., through cluster
analysis).
- Describe clusters based on preferences (identify attributes (preferences/benefits) that are
important) and additional variables (understand customer groups to define segment-
specific strategies.

 different clusters might need different approaches.




Competitor segmentation
Can make the market gap obvious and define most important competitors.

Mobility barriers between strategic groups
- Inhibit or prevent businesses from entering or moving from one strategic group to
another.
- Influence profit potential.
Examples: brand reputation, product quality, manufacturing knowledge, customer base.

Strategic groups: identify current and potential future competitors (e.g., through resource-based
concept).
Strategic group: the group of firms in an industry following the same or a similar strategy along
the strategic dimensions.
- Similar competitive strategy (distribution channels,
communication strategy).
